Output c258687cbc54b1ec71a7aabcfb2d305875028cd1dd9f73bb959a08dfdf2435fd:0

value
53764260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 421fe884d415bc8e77f978269a73a0a58b3e4bab OP_EQUALVERIFY OP_CHECKSIG
address
172dpgqDZvL5sKgu2m1e5XFcLjp6E6J3eZ
transaction
c258687cbc54b1ec71a7aabcfb2d305875028cd1dd9f73bb959a08dfdf2435fd
confirmations
412443
spent
true